Ventilator Stress Assistance: What Is It?

Understanding the Idea of Stress Support Ventilation

Pressure support ventilation (PSV) is a setting where the ventilator helps patients by giving a preset level of pressure during breathing. It's specifically beneficial for patients that can initiate their breaths however need aid with airflow.

When Is Stress Assistance Used?

This setting is frequently used in cases such as:

    Patients recovering from surgery Individuals experiencing acute respiratory distress Long-term ventilation situations where discouraging off mechanical support is required

Why Is Tracheostomy Important?

A tracheostomy allows direct access to the airway via a cut made in the trachea. For many individuals calling for long-lasting ventilation, this treatment comes to be necessary when typical endotracheal intubation stops working or is not feasible.

Integrating Tracheostomy Monitoring right into Air Flow Courses

Courses concentrating on tracheostomy monitoring cover:

    Techniques for looking after tracheostomy tubes Emergency protocols associated with dislodgement or blockage Best techniques for suctioning and preserving air passage patency

Comprehensive Airway Management and Ventilation Techniques

The Importance of Comprehensive Air Passage Administration Skills

Effective airway management encompasses not just maintaining patency yet additionally ensuring that ideal oxygenation occurs throughout basic ventilator course treatment. This consists of understanding different modalities such as CPAP (Constant Positive Airway Pressure) or BiPAP (Bilevel Favorable Airway Pressure).

Key Components Covered in Respiratory Tract Administration Training:

Recognizing indicators of air passage compromise Performing bag-mask ventilation effectively Implementing advanced air passage techniques when necessary
